百度试题 结果1 题目如果一个函数的返回类型是void,这意味着什么? A. 函数不返回任何值 B. 函数返回一个整数 C. 函数返回一个浮点数 D. 函数返回一个字符 相关知识点: 试题来源: 解析 A 反馈 收藏
void 是没有任何返回值, 而 void * 是返回任意类型的值的指针.还是看代码吧:#include <stdlib.h>#...
或者说return后面就不应该带有值。返回类型为void,就说明这个函数无需返回值,那么当你需要函数返回时直...
VOID本身的含意就是空。所以void 就是返回空,即什么也不返回。常见的写法有:void main(void){}
malloc 函数返回的指针就是 void * 型,用户在使用这个指针的时候,要进行强制类型转换 include <stdlib.h> include <iostream> void* voidcp(int& a){ return &a;} int main(){ int a = 10;int* ap = (int*)voidcp(a);std::cout << (*ap) << std::endl;return 0;} ...
void可以返回一个空指针或者什么也不返回,int 函数必须要返回一个整形的值,如果没有return ,不会报错,但是编译器有警告。
不是void,例如是int ,那么就返回一个整数,return 1;
如果一个函数声明返回类型为void,那么在其中就不应该写 return 0; 或者说return后面就不应该带有值...
void函数是无返回值的,定义一个void函数后,会运行函数中的代码,无需返回值。如需返回值就定义非void型函数,而这个返回值一般情况下和函数同类型。 0 Tender10 2017-08-19 如果你想返回整型数据就是int,返回浮点数就是float,返回值类型的确定和定义类型的时候是类似的,需要返回什么类型就写什么类型即可。 0 ...
void类型就是无返回值类型的,如果你缺省,在函数名前面不加void的话,系统默认的是int类型的,